基于磷光材料的有机电致白光器件的研究进展

摘    要:有机电致白光器件是近年来国际上的一个研究热点,它不仅可以作为液晶显示的背光源,也是未来照明技术的有效光源。有机磷光电致发光可以同时利用单重态和三重态的激子,理论上可使器件的内量子效率达到100%,而在近几年倍受关注。文章介绍了磷光材料的有机电致白光器件的研究进展,按多发射层、多重掺杂单发射层、单重掺杂单发射层以及基于激发二聚体和激基复合物发射4种结构进行了分析和阐述。

Abstract:White organic light-emitting devices(WOLEDs)has become a fascinating field in recent years.WOLEDs can be used for backlight of LCD and illumination sources in the future.Electroluminescences based on organic phosphorescent complexes has drawn particular attention in recent years.The advantage of phosphorescence is that they can utilize both singlet and triplet exciton states which can reach to 100 % internal quantum efficiency theoretically.There are four structures of fabricating WOLEDs based on phosphorescent materials.According to multiple emissive layers,the WOLEDs can be divided into multiple-doped layers and single emissive layer,single doped and single emissive layer WOLEDs based on excimer and exciplex emissions.
